About Living Stones Christian Centre
What you're really coming here for is the peace and the chance to sit quietly if that's what you need. There's no theatre to it, no gift shop pressure. If you're into ecclesiastical architecture you'll find this straightforward and unpretentious. For families, it depends entirely on whether your lot can manage a calm half-hour without needing entertainment.
The setting matters. Argyll's proper countryside - you're not far from some decent walks and the landscape has that wild, slightly austere beauty that makes you want to stay a bit longer than you planned. If you're staying at The Pod Over By just down the road, it's close enough for a Sunday morning visit without any faffing about.
Best approach this as part of a broader day rather than a destination in itself. Combine it with a walk around Lochgilphead's waterfront or a drive through the local glens. Go early if you want it quiet, avoid service times if you'd rather not join in. Admission is free, naturally - churches tend to be. Allow twenty minutes, half an hour maximum unless you're genuinely seeking solitude.
